2. Step by Step Procedure
• Right click the feature file and Open Layer Properties.
• Go to Labels Tab.
• Check the Label feature in this layer.
• Select the Label field name.
• One can change text, through Text symbol option:
• Font
• Color
• Size
• One can access the Label option through Context Menu, if above mentioned
process is previously done.

5. Exploring the Labeling Options
• Few of the labeling options available are:
• Placement Properties:
• Showing the options how to place the labels upon the features.
• Scale Range:
• To restrict at which scale, the labels are to be shown or not.
• Label Style Selector:
• To change the font, style size, color etc.
